In which cases is sperm freezing and cryopreservation applicable
The initial step for the evaluation of male fertility is the assesment of basic sperm parameters including conventional qualitative and quantitative characteristics.
Sperm freezing and cryopreservation is recommended to men who will be exposed to toxic environmental factors or submitted to surgical or other kind of medical treatments which may cause infertility.
This method is applied in cases of men who face cancer and have not yet created or completed their family.
Anticancer treatment (surgical, chemotherapy or radiotherapy) may result in temporary or permanent sterility. However, it is not possible to predict with certainty the severity of the effect or its duration.
